How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Nature View?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Nature View Studio Apartments | $1,417 | $995 | $2,585 |
Nature View 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,635 | $900 | $9,386 |
Nature View 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,027 | $1,189 | $6,698 |
Nature View 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,663 | $1,650 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Low Income Nature View Apartments
What is the Cheapest Low Income apartment in Nature View?
Currently the most affordable Low Income Apartment in Nature View is at Allen Avenue listed at $1,150.
How much is the average rent for a Low Income Nature View Apartment?
The average rent for a Low Income Apartment in Nature View is $1,509.
What is the largest Low Income Nature View Apartment for rent?
Today's Low Income apartment with the most square footage in Nature View is a 1,399 square feet unit starting from $1,416 at Legacy Commons at Signal Hills 55+ Apartments.
What is the average size for Nature View Low Income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Low Income rental in Nature View is currently at 722 sq ft.
